Rising Temperatures and Habitat Loss
One of the most significant effects of climate change is the increase in global temperatures. For penguins, especially those living in the Antarctic region, rising temperatures can lead to habitat loss. Ice shelves are melting at alarming rates, reducing the breeding and nesting grounds essential for penguin colonies.
Melting Ice and Breeding Grounds
Penguins rely on stable ice conditions to breed and raise their chicks. As ice melts, penguins are forced to relocate to less suitable areas, which can lead to increased competition for resources and a decline in successful breeding outcomes. This shift not only affects penguin populations but also disrupts the entire marine ecosystem.
Changes in Food Availability
Climate change also affects the availability of food sources for penguins. Many species of fish and krill, which are primary food sources for penguins, are sensitive to temperature changes and ocean acidification. As these species migrate to cooler waters, penguins may struggle to find sufficient food, leading to malnutrition and decreased reproductive success.
Impact on Krill Populations
Krill, a small crustacean that serves as a vital food source for many penguin species, is particularly vulnerable to climate change. Warmer ocean temperatures and changing sea ice conditions can reduce krill populations, impacting penguins that depend on them for survival. A decline in krill not only affects penguins but also has a cascading effect on the broader marine food web.
Extreme Weather Events
Climate change is also associated with an increase in the frequency and severity of extreme weather events. Penguins are vulnerable to storms, which can disrupt breeding seasons and lead to the loss of eggs and chicks. Additionally, heavy rainfall can cause flooding in nesting areas, further threatening the survival of young penguins.
Effects of Storms on Breeding Success
Extreme weather events can cause significant mortality rates among penguin chicks. For instance, heavy storms can wash away nests or overwhelm colonies with water, leading to high chick mortality. These events can disrupt the delicate balance of penguin populations, making it difficult for them to recover.
Conservation Efforts and Future Outlook
Recognizing the threats posed by climate change, various conservation efforts are underway to protect penguin populations. Organizations are focusing on habitat preservation, research, and climate action to help mitigate the impacts of climate change. Sustainable fishing practices, marine protected areas, and climate change awareness campaigns are critical components of these efforts.
Role of Research and Monitoring
Research plays a crucial role in understanding how climate change affects penguins. Ongoing monitoring of penguin populations and their habitats helps conservationists develop targeted strategies to protect these species. By understanding the specific challenges penguins face, more effective conservation measures can be implemented.
